Due to unforeseen circumstances, the final Queens Symphony Orchestra opera-themed concert at Russo’s on the Bay has been rescheduled to Monday, June 24, at 7 p.m. from Wednesday, June 26, City Councilman Eric Ulrich (R-Ozone Park) recently announced.
There are no other changes to the series. The next concert will take place on Monday, June 10, at 7 p.m. at Nativity of the Blessed Virgin Mary (101-41 91st St., Ozone Park), as scheduled.
Funded through Ulrich’s office, all concerts are free-of-charge, but space is limited. To RSVP, constituents may call the councilman’s district office at (718) 738-1083. Please note: Residents who have already RSVP’d to the final concert at Russo’s do not have to RSVP again.
